Osaka Train
Notes: words and music
by Malvina Reynolds; copyright 1977 Schroder Music Company, renewed 2005.
Concerning a brief encounter during a tour of Japan in 1970.
What's in the seat up ahead?
Neat little top-knot of black shiny hair,
Young girl I meet on the train,
Brightened the way to the Osaka Fair,
Like the flower that I see from the train window,
I never will see it again.
So for me it will always remain
Just as I saw it and always the same,
Just as I saw it, perfect and dear,
Girl with the top-knot of black shiny hair.
